Word for a male that prefers female companions (no slang such as "pimp")

After doing some round-about searching (i.e., searching the wiki archives starting with "friendship"), I believe I found the word I was looking for: heterosocial, meaning prefering non-sexual relations with the opposite sex. Thus the man in question (whose wiki page I'm likely to never come across again) was exclusively heterosocial, ascribing to him a fondness (of a non-sexual nature) of only female acquaintances and who, with a dearth of a heteronormative love life, could be perceived to be homosexual.

For a long time, the standard name for such a person has been lady's man.

lady's man also ladies' man
A man who enjoys and attracts the company of women.